| I would wait til your missed period. If you test early you run the risk of a false negative. But if you are eager you can go ahead and test up to 5 days before your missed period just remember that if it is false it could be wrong or it could be right. You won't know for sure til that wonderful missed period. |

| Having sex every other day would definately cover your basis and ensure that you have sex sometime around when you ovulate. Since you just started using clomid it might take a few cycles for you to really know your body and what to expect. Once you know your cycles it will be much easier to find when you ovulate.
